What is the Request for Quotation (RFQ)?
The Request for Quotation (RFQ) form is a critical document used by the Department of Agriculture in the Philippines to solicit price quotations from potential suppliers. This procurement form holds specific fields that gather key information necessary for evaluating supplier offerings. Included in the form are sections for company details, item descriptions, quantities needed, unit costs, and delivery information.
By utilizing the request for quotation form, organizations can initiate a structured process to obtain supplier quotation requests effectively, allowing for an organized comparison of costs and options during procurement.

Who Needs to Complete the Request for Quotation?
The RFQ form is primarily used by company representatives and canvassers who are tasked with obtaining pricing information from suppliers. Different sectors, including agriculture, manufacturing, and retail, often require this form to facilitate procurement activities.
Businesses of all sizes can benefit from the structured approach of the supplier quotation request, ensuring they gather necessary information to make informed purchasing decisions.

Common Errors When Completing the Request for Quotation
When filling out the RFQ, users often encounter common errors that can hinder the submission process. Frequent mistakes include missing signatures, incorrect quantities, and incomplete item descriptions. To avoid these pitfalls, thorough reviews of the RFQ form are recommended.
Users should double-check all entered information, ensuring that it is accurate and complete before final submission, thus preventing any delays in the procurement cycle.

Who is eligible to submit the Request for Quotation form?
Any company representative or designated canvasser is eligible to submit the Request for Quotation form, provided they have the necessary business details and intended item procurement information.
Is there a deadline for submitting the RFQ form?
Yes, the RFQ form must be submitted within the specified timeframe set by the Department of Agriculture to ensure consideration for procurement. Check the form for specific deadlines.
How can I submit the RFQ form once completed?
You can submit the RFQ form either by downloading and sending it via email or using the submission options available within pdfFiller, depending on the submitting authority's requirements.
What supporting documents are needed when submitting this form?
While the RFQ form primarily requires company and item information, you may need to provide additional documents such as business credentials or previous quotations, if specified.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the RFQ form?
Common mistakes include failing to sign the form, omitting required item details, or not adhering to specific format requirements. Always double-check your entries before submission.
How long does it take to process the RFQ after submission?
Processing times for the RFQ can vary depending on the department's workload. Typically, you can expect a response within a few weeks, so plan accordingly.
Do I need to notarize the RFQ form?
No, the Request for Quotation form does not require notarization. However, it must be signed by the designated representatives before submission.
